From 5b55813585a26dc2f73e11c8e1282753010d6111 Mon Sep 17 00:00:00 2001 From: Aakash Kattelu Date: Wed, 12 Aug 2026 18:03:10 -0400 Subject: [PATCH] fix(embedding): guarantee truncation progress and truncate on re-embed The retry slice in _truncate_to_token_limit always recomputed the same keep count, so a slice whose re-encode grew past the cap could oscillate. Decrement keep after each unsuccessful retry. Document re-embed in the reconciler used the default on_oversize="raise", so one oversize document failed every other document in the batch.
